Summary
Dr. Jayson Malufau is a family medicine physician who earned his medical degree from Touro University Nevada College of Osteopathic Medicine. With 11 years of experience in healthcare, he provides comprehensive primary care services to patients and families. His osteopathic training emphasizes a whole-person approach to medicine that focuses on preventive care and the body's natural ability to heal.
Dr. Malufau practices at Intermountain Health Saint George Regional Hospital in Saint George, Utah, and maintains affiliations with Ogden Regional Medical Center and Kingman Regional Medical Center. He specializes in managing complex conditions including type 2 diabetes and treating various wound-related issues such as open wounds and venous skin ulcers. His expertise includes chronic wound care procedures and wound debridement techniques, helping patients heal from difficult-to-treat injuries and ulcers.
